Definitionen

bogtrotter
Substantiv
raiting
UK
/ˈbɒɡˌtrɒtə/
US
/ˈbɔɡˌtrɑtər/
(chiefly derogatory, historical) An Irish person, especially one from rural areas or boggy regions.
In 19th-century England, Irish labourers were often disparagingly called 'bogtrotters'.
(dated) A person or animal that habitually traverses or lives in bogs; specifically, a wading bird such as a snipe.
The seasoned bogtrotter led the hikers safely across the marsh.
